If you’re in charge of foster family recruitment for your agency, you know that it’s a strategic process that requires careful planning and execution. There is a lot of noise out there when it comes to recruiting foster families — whether it’s misinformation, fear, or simply a lack of awareness about the foster care system.

That’s why it’s so important to use signal data to cut through the noise and find qualified families who are truly interested in fostering. Signal data refers to specific, actionable information that can help you identify potential foster parents who are likely to be successful in their roles.

Here are three ways to use signal data in your foster family recruitment strategy:

Use online analytics to track website traffic and engagement. By analyzing data on website traffic, you can identify which pages or content are most popular with prospective foster parents. This can help you tailor your messaging and approach to better meet the needs and interests of your target audience.

Leverage social media to gather feedback and insights from existing foster parents. By engaging with foster parents on social media, you can learn more about their experiences, challenges, and successes. This can help you identify common themes and issues that you can address in your recruitment efforts.

Collect and analyze data on the characteristics of successful foster families. By identifying common traits and characteristics of successful foster parents, you can develop targeted recruitment strategies that are more likely to attract these types of families.

Keep these things in mind as you work to create a successful recruitment strategy for your agency. By focusing on signal data, you can separate the noise from the actionable information and make more informed decisions about your recruitment efforts.
